Forty eight (48) persons have died on Monday (26) increasing the country’s death toll from the virus to 4,195, Director General of Health Services confirmed today (28).
Out of the daily deaths, the majority were males (28) and 20 females. Thirty eight persons who succumbed to the virus are above 60 years of age.
Meanwhile, 1,688 persons were tested positive for COVID-19 yesterday (27) bringing the total number of infected persons in the country to 299,869, the Epidemiology Unit said.
